Easy hiking trails in St. Clair County offer diverse landscapes, from abundant greenery and waterways in Michigan to riverine greenways and historic sites in Illinois. The terrain is generally flat, featuring numerous parks, nature preserves, and scenic paths. Hikers can explore woodlands, wetlands, and open meadows, with minimal elevation changes across the region.

Blackwell Trails Park features a wide, fine gravel network of loop trails that winds through meadows, wetlands, and a couple of large ponds. The trails are mostly flat with minimal tree cover, so it can get hot in the middle of the day, and it’s quite windy in the winter. Because there’s not much shade, I recommend going with a hat and sunglasses on sunny days. Also, ticks are common in the long grass along the trail, so staying on the path and checking yourself afterward is a good idea. Enjoy the parks trails and take the opportunity to walk around.

Lake St. Clair, also known as Lake St. Clair, is a freshwater lake located between the Canadian province of Ontario and the U.S. state of Michigan, north of Detroit. It is sometimes referred to as "the sixth Great Lake," although it is not considered part of the Great Lakes system.

Easy hikes in St. Clair County generally feature flat terrain, with minimal elevation changes. You'll find diverse landscapes, including lakeplain prairies, oak savannas, woodlands, wetlands, and riverine greenways, offering varied scenery without challenging ascents.

Absolutely. St. Clair County boasts trails with unique natural features. For instance, the James and Alice Brennan Memorial Nature Sanctuary offers secluded wooded areas along the Pine River, while Algonac State Park features lakeplain prairie and oak savannas. You can also explore the Woodsong County Park MTB Route for unique views from a vista overlooking the Black River.
